Kelechi Iheanacho played a vital role in Leicester City 2-1 victory over Everton by recording an assist for Vardy before scoring a 90th minute winner to give Leicester City the maximum points in the premier league.
Richarlison gave Everton the lead in the 23rd minute and Leicester found it difficult to break down the hosts who set up in a 5-4-1 formation in a bid to deny Leicester City an important win.
Kelechi Iheanacho came on for Ayoze Perez in the 62nd minute few minutes later he assisted Jamie Vardy to restore parity for the visitors.
Iheanacho completed his impressive cameo performance by scoring a 90th minute winner to send Leicester City fans into wild jubilation.
Iheanacho made his first appearance of the season in the premier league and he played a major role in the victory, he will be hoping to start their next premier league match against Watford.
Wilfred Ndidi started from start to finish, while Alex Iwobi was replaced by Mois Kean in the 78th minute.
